If you’re a Mac user who loves gaming, encountering issues with Steam can be a frustrating experience. Many gamers rely on Steam for their favorite titles, but sometimes this platform simply fails to work as expected. Whether you’re unable to launch the app, facing errors, or encountering connectivity issues, this comprehensive guide serves as your go-to resource for troubleshooting Steam problems on your Mac.
Understanding the Common Issues with Steam on Mac
Before diving into solutions, it’s essential to understand the common issues that Mac users might face with Steam. These problems usually fall into specific categories, including:
1. Installation Issues
Sometimes, users face challenges when installing Steam or updating the application. This can stem from insufficient disk space, system permissions, or a corrupted installation file.
2. Application Launch Failures
You may click the Steam icon only to find that nothing happens. This is a common issue for many users, often linked to system incompatibilities or corrupted game files.
3. Connectivity Problems
Steam requires a stable internet connection to function correctly. If you’re experiencing slow download speeds or connectivity failures, this can lead to a poor gaming experience.
4. Game-Specific Errors
Certain games may not run optimally on Steam even if the platform itself is working. This could be due to outdated game files or compatibility issues with your Mac’s operating system.
Step-by-Step Solutions to Fix Steam on Mac
Let’s dive into practical solutions for making Steam work smoothly on your Mac.
1. Update Your macOS
A common cause for applications like Steam not working is an outdated operating system. Steam frequently updates its platform to stay optimized, requiring the latest macOS version.
- Click on the Apple icon in the top left corner of your screen.
- Select “System Preferences.”
- Click on “Software Update” and install any available updates.
Having the latest macOS not only enhances performance but can also fix underlying compatibility issues with Steam.
2. Check Your Internet Connection
Since Steam depends on a reliable internet connection, it’s crucial to ensure your network is working correctly. Here’s how to check:
- Try loading a website on your browser to confirm your internet connectivity.
- Restart your modem or router.
If your internet is slow or unstable, reaching out to your internet service provider may be necessary.
3. Reinstall Steam
If Steam is still not launching or functioning as expected, a complete reinstallation might be necessary. Here’s how:
Step to Uninstall Steam:
- Navigate to the “Applications” folder.
- Locate the Steam application.
- Drag it to the Trash and remove it.
Step to Reinstall Steam:
- Go to the official Steam website.
- Download the latest version of the Steam client for Mac.
- Install the application again.
Reinstallation often resolves many persistent issues that simple updates cannot.
4. Clear Steam’s Cache
Steam has a cache that stores data to improve loading times and functionality. However, a corrupted cache can lead to performance issues. Clearing this cache is relatively straightforward:
- Open Steam.
- Navigate to “Steam” in the top menu and select “Preferences.”
- Click on the “Downloads” tab and look for “Clear Download Cache.”
- Confirm your action and let Steam restart.
Clearing the cache can give Steam a fresh start and improve its performance.
5. Check for Conflicting Programs
Sometimes, other applications running in the background may conflict with Steam. This could be antivirus software, firewalls, or other gaming clients (like Epic Games or Origin).
To troubleshoot:
1. Temporarily disable any antivirus or firewall programs and see if Steam works.
2. Ensure no other gaming clients are running.
Make sure to re-enable your antivirus after the test to keep your system secure.
Advanced Troubleshooting Tips for Persistent Issues
If you’re still having trouble after trying these basic fixes, consider these advanced strategies.
1. Modify Steam Launch Options
Sometimes, Steam requires specific launch options for better performance with certain games.
- Open Steam and navigate to your library.
- Right-click on the game that isn’t launching properly and select “Properties.”
- In the General tab, find the “Launch Options” textbox.
- Enter optimized launch commands compatible with your game.
Optimizing launch options can help resolve games that struggle to run on your Mac.
2. Adjust Compatibility Settings
Sometimes the issue may relate to incompatibilities with particular games. You can adjust compatibility settings by:
- Right-clicking on the game in your Steam library.
- Selecting “Properties,” then going to the Compatibility tab.
- Adjust settings like “Run this program in compatibility mode” if available.
This can sometimes help if you’re playing older titles that might not run well on newer macOS versions.
3. Inspect Your Security and Privacy Settings
Mac has built-in security settings that may inadvertently block applications from running correctly. To check these:
- Go to “System Preferences.”
- Click on “Security & Privacy.”
- Under the “General” tab, make sure “Allow apps downloaded from” includes the option for “App Store and identified developers.”
Ensuring that Steam is permitted under these settings can alleviate many blocking issues.
Diagnosing Hardware Issues
If you continue to have problems with Steam after trying all these methods, it may be worth investigating your hardware.
1. Check Disk Space
Insufficient disk space can cause numerous application issues. To check your disk usage:
- Click on the Apple icon and select “About This Mac.”
- Go to the “Storage” tab to view available disk space.
Ensure you have ample space for Steam and your games; ideally, at least 15-20% of your disk should be free.
2. Perform a Hardware Check
Possible memory or hardware failures can cause application issues. Consider running Apple Diagnostics:
- Shut down your Mac.
- Turn it on and immediately press and hold the D key until the diagnostic starts.
Follow the on-screen instructions to perform a check.
Conclusion: Ensuring a Seamless Gaming Experience
Steam is a fantastic platform for gaming on your Mac, but it can sometimes present challenges. By understanding common issues and applying the troubleshooting steps outlined in this article, you can effectively resolve your Steam-related problems and enhance your gaming experience.
It’s all about patience and persistence. From ensuring you have the right macOS version to checking for conflicts with other applications, there are numerous ways to tackle Steam issues on your Mac. Remember, maintaining a good practice of regularly updating your software and backing up your system will not only keep Steam running smoothly but will also contribute to the overall health of your Mac.
Happy gaming!
What should I do if Steam won’t open on my Mac?
If Steam won’t open on your Mac, the first step is to check for any available updates for both the Steam application and your macOS. To update Steam, you can visit the official Steam website, download the latest version, and reinstall it. For macOS, go to the Apple menu, select “About This Mac,” and click on “Software Update” to check for system updates. Sometimes, compatibility issues can be resolved through updates.
If updating doesn’t resolve the issue, try clearing the Steam cache. This can be done by deleting the “ClientRegistry.blob” file located in the Steam directory under “Library/Application Support/Steam.” After deleting this file, restart your Mac and then attempt to launch Steam again. If the problem persists, consider reinstalling Steam completely to ensure that you have a fresh and fully functional installation.
Why is Steam crashing on my Mac?
Steam can crash on your Mac due to various reasons, including software conflicts, corrupted files, or insufficient system resources. Start by closing any unnecessary applications that may be consuming system resources. You can check your Activity Monitor to identify these apps. Once you close the excess programs, try launching Steam again to see if it functions correctly.
If the crashes continue, consider verifying the integrity of the game files. Right-click on the game in your Steam library, select “Properties,” and then click on the “Local Files” tab to find the “Verify Integrity of Game Files” option. This process checks for any missing or corrupted game files and replaces them. If it still crashes after this step, you may want to check for any recent changes to your system, such as new software installations or updates, that might be causing the conflict.
How can I fix a slow Steam download speed on Mac?
If you’re experiencing slow download speeds on Steam, start by checking your internet connection. Make sure your Mac is connected to the internet with stable connectivity, and consider restarting your router to refresh the connection. Additionally, check for other devices using the same network that may be consuming bandwidth, which could affect your download speeds on Steam.
Another effective solution is to change the download region within the Steam settings. Go to “Steam” in the top menu, select “Settings,” and click on the “Downloads” tab. From there, change the “Download Region” to a different server that might provide better speeds. After making this change, restart Steam and see if download speeds improve. Remember, choosing a server closer to your physical location typically yields faster speeds.
What if my Steam games won’t launch on my Mac?
If your Steam games won’t launch on your Mac, the first step is to ensure that your graphics drivers are up to date. Check the Apple menu for any updates to your system, as macOS often includes essential driver updates with its software updates. Additionally, ensure that the game is compatible with the current version of macOS you are using.
You may also want to try launching the game in Safe Mode. To do this, hold down the Shift key while starting the game through Steam. If the game launches successfully in Safe Mode, it may indicate an issue with settings or graphics configurations. From there, you can adjust the in-game settings or revert to default configurations to identify what might be causing the launch issues.
How do I resolve Steam login issues on my Mac?
Login issues with Steam on your Mac can stem from various factors, including incorrect username or password, poor network connection, or Steam server outages. Begin by ensuring you’re entering the correct login credentials. If you’re unsure, consider resetting your password using the “Forgot Password” link on the Steam login page.
If you’re confident in your credentials but still cannot log in, check the Steam status page to see if there are any current outages affecting their servers. Additionally, verify your internet connection to ensure you have stable access. If the problem remains unresolved, clearing Steam’s app cache might help; navigate to the Steam directory and delete the config
folder, which can sometimes fix persistent login problems.
What should I do if I encounter error messages on Steam?
Encountering error messages on Steam can be frustrating, but many of these can be resolved with a few troubleshooting steps. First, take note of the specific error code or message you receive, as this can provide clues for resolving the issue. Many common problems can often be addressed through a quick Google search or by checking Steam’s support forum for similar cases and solutions.
If the error persists, try restarting Steam and your Mac. Sometimes, temporary glitches can cause error messages, and a simple reboot may be sufficient to clear them. If problems continue, you can try re-installing Steam, although be sure to back up your game files, if necessary. As a last resort, consider reaching out to Steam Support for further assistance with the specific error you are facing.